With a unique profile, the Anemone Collection takes characteristics from Mid-Century Modern style and adapts them for today s sleek urban design sensibilities. Seven Edison bulbs are meticulously arranged around a central column, creating a burst of warm, atmospheric light in your high vaulted ceiling entryway. Available in a mysterious oil rubbed bronze, a lustrous brushed steel or a dynamic antique brass finish, the Anemone Collection provides just the right amount of contemporary glam to nearly any living space.
